Frequently Asked Questions

How often should I have my marine A/C system serviced?
For optimal performance and to prevent costly repairs, we recommend a full system check-up at least twice a year: once before the heavy summer season and once as you prepare for winter layup. For the old salt who runs their vessel year-round in sunny Florida, a quarterly check is even better. It keeps your system from becoming a bilge rat's nest of problems.
What is involved in a descaling or acid flush service?
Over time, marine growth and scale build up inside your A/C's raw water lines, restricting flow and causing high-pressure faults. Our descaling service involves circulating a specialized, environmentally-safe acid solution through the system to dissolve this buildup completely. It’s like a full turnaround day for your cooling system, restoring it to peak efficiency.
Can I replace the air filters myself?
Absolutely, and you should! We recommend checking and cleaning or replacing your air filters every month, especially during heavy use. It's a simple task that significantly improves air quality and system efficiency. If you're unsure what to get, give us a call—we hear all the dock talk and can point you to the right parts.
Why is my A/C system not cooling as well as it used to?
A drop in cooling performance can be due to several factors: low refrigerant, a clogged sea strainer, restricted airflow from dirty filters, or internal scale buildup.
